Description ~ Phoenix From the Ashes

Embrace your knitting challenges! Things are rarely as bad as they seem. Learn how to take stock of a new project to determine all is going according to plan. Re-thinking and revising. Swatches and how to read them honestly. Plan to practice 'defensive knitting', to keep your options open.


Materials Needed ~ Phoenix From the Ashes

  • Usual knitting paraphernalia
  • Crochet hook
  • Scissors
  • Blunt darning needles
  • A pair of knitting needles
  • At least two short length (6") dpns smaller in size than used for your swatch, ideally made from a lightweight material (bamboo or wood).
  • Small amounts of similar weight, brightly contrasting yarn in at least three colors.


Homework ~ Phoenix From the Ashes

Swatch required. In a light, single-color, smooth, wool-rich yarn in a worsted weight or heavier (avoid single-ply or Lopi yarns if possible), cast on 60 sts and work 3+" of Stocking stitch (knit one row, purl one row), end on completion of a purl row. Cut off yarn and leave the stitches on the needle. (If in the finishing class your swatches can be repurposed.)
